Hi,

I'm not really a scambaiter, but a friend of mine replied to a yahoo phish and his e-mail was hijacked.

Once that was done the phisherman sent emails to all the contacts saying he is stranded in africa and needs money to get home.

I replied that I could send 1000 of the 1500 he asked for, and that I thought he was in Guatamala.

at any rate, I have him waiting for money to be sent to the western union.

My friend has tried to contact yahoo, but as yet, hasn't gotten a reply.
Western Union told him to file a complaint with the fbi white collar crime site.

Anyone have any ideas how we can bust the phisher?

As stated a lot here, if you're using your real information (email address, etc.) drop correspondence with this person. Read the Stickies on how to bait safely first. You can then re-bait from an anonymous email account with the same message, since the scammer won't be checking your address first.

You can post the mail headers here (omitting any personal information) and we'll see if we can assist in telling you the location of the scammer. I'll be surprised if the scammer is actually anywhere in Africa at all.

Nothing you can do about phishers. Nothing much you can do about the scammer either. I don't quit understand what happened. If your friend gave out his account info and password then hopefully he learned something. I also hope he didn't use that same password for all his other accounts. I assume he doesn't have access to the account any longer. They got into the account using his info and changed the password. Yahoo can disable the account.

Just ignore the emails and move on.
